70 int aflag; /* translate network and broadcast addresses */
71 int dflag; /* print filter code */
72 int eflag; /* print ethernet header */
73 int fflag; /* don't translate "foreign" IP address */
74 int nflag; /* leave addresses as numbers */
75 int Nflag; /* remove domains from printed host names */
76 int Oflag = 1; /* run filter code optimizer */
77 int pflag; /* don't go promiscuous */
78 int qflag; /* quick (shorter) output */
79 int Rflag = 1; /* print sequence # field in AH/ESP*/
80 int sflag = 0; /* use the libsmi to translate OIDs */
81 int Sflag; /* print raw TCP sequence numbers */
82 int tflag = 1; /* print packet arrival time */
83 int uflag = 0; /* Print undecoded NFS handles */
84 int vflag; /* verbose */
85 int xflag; /* print packet in hex */
86 int Xflag; /* print packet in ascii as well as hex */
87 off_t Cflag = 0; /* rotate dump files after this many bytes */
